Estimated Time shows a prediction of how long it would take you to ride a given route. This number is based on your recent riding history, and represents an estimate of moving time. Each time you upload a new ride, your Estimated Time profile will adjust to reflect your most recent riding. Only rides exceeding 10 miles (16 km) will affect these estimates.

I was undecided whether to ride in our out doors. I got up around 6am today. I had stuff to do. I took my morning nap around 11:30ish. So, that delayed my departure till after 2pm. Nevertheless, I decided to ride out-doors. I wore the winter kit and my jacket. Temperature around 40 degrees + wind chill. I felt good from the start. Didn't take much time to get warmed up. The legs felt responsive. The cool air helped, especially on the uphills. When I reached the summit of Banducci, I was convinced to do the Tour de Teh (R) route. So, that's what I did. I brought my face mask, so going down the mountain wasn't too painful. I put it in cruise control around CV. Doing no less than moderate tempo. On the last climb, I sort of tested myself. This will be the last climb of the day, come GranFondo 2018. I wanted to see what it would be like to put the pedal to the metal. I felt good. Redlining the better half of the ascent. I had no ailments to hinder me, so my HR was maxed when I reached the summit. I should have set the GPS to the Watt/Kg screen, but forgot. I was doing over 200 watts on the steeper sections. Probably closer to 300. After reaching the summit, it was recover and make it back home. I think I made the right choice in not doing the SS loop, as it was late in the day and was starting to get colder. Concentration was spot on. Balance and form felt good. Ailments, none. Gear is working well. The Gopro twist bolt came off as I was ascending Banducci. I turned around to pick it up and put it back on. Other than that, no issues. Other notes, no other cyclists today.
